Turkey sees nearly 22,000 fresh COVID cases
Region
- 03 December, 2021
- 07:27
Turkey recorded 21,747 new cases of coronavirus infection over the past day, Report informs via Anadolu Agency.
The virus killed 192 people in the country during the day.
Meanwhile, 22,284 patients who previously contracted the virus recovered from the illness.
More than 120.6 million doses of COVID vaccines have been administered in Turkey so far.
As stated by the Turkish Ministry of Health, 90.73% of Turkey's population has received the first dose, and 81.44% received both shots.
